TSF20H200C C0G

TSF20H200C C0G

  • 厂商:

    TAIWANSEMICONDUCTOR(台半)

  • 封装:

    TO-220-3

  • 描述:

    DIODE ARRAY SCHOTT 200V ITO220AB
